The article I selected this week, Classroom Universals to Prevent Problem Behaviors, was written by Robert P. Trussell. There are two pieces of knowledge I gained about my topic as a result of the article I selected this week. First, this article mentions how it is important for teachers to develop daily schedules for their classroom and to make sure that the schedule is clearly visible to all students. The article mentions how when there is unscheduled time in a classroom, that gives the students an open invitation for disruptive behavior. I had never really thought about how important displaying the daily schedule would be before reading this article. I have noticed at my daughter’s middle school the daily schedule is displayed but I never knew why. Second, this article mentions that wait time is the amount of time a teacher waits for a student to respond after being asked a question or a prompt. According to this article, the longer a teacher waits for a response, the higher the student’s cognitive achievement is due to the students having ample time to think through the question or prompt.
